Between e-bay and Paypal the fee is approx. 13%. If you have the time, you can make money. For example if you have a collection you are willing to part with, that can set you up. I know people who have sold their old Barbie Dolls and toys and they made money. It might not be a lot unless you are really dedicated, but it's more than internet boards lol
